Runbook: Fuelscope account recovery. If the nightly fleet fuel-usage report stops generating, odds are the Fuelscope service account got locked again — it happens after the Carrowfield depot uploads malformed CSVs. Don't create a new account; just recover the existing one so historical report links keep working. Head to the admin recovery page, pick the service account, and enter the recovery passphrase below.

unlock words, yawig-kagef: gordor-holvan-ulaael-pramir-ulaiel-tamdor

**Runbook 7.2 — Replacement server, Maplereach branch**

Heads up, Maplereach team: the replacement Ironvale R40 server ships out Monday from the Cobbleton staging room. It arrives in a black flight case — don't open it on the dock; take it straight to the comms room. Check the tamper seals and sign the transit sheet. For the actual hand-off, the courier instruction is noted just below.

courier memo of hawep-fahif: the fraiel gilion courier leaves the sileth quenvan eliox istath gilath lamius gilion zorys ledger at gate 4230 under passcode 798582

Heads up: the Ferrowbase CI job for the admin bulk-edit flow started failing after we added row-level permission checks. Turns out the test fixture edits 500 rows as a viewer-role account, which is now (correctly) rejected. Not a regression — the old behavior was the actual hole. I swapped the fixture to an operator account. To reproduce the green run, grab the build token below.

trace token, fafog-kageg: htk4_98e6